Discover the Serenity of Nolde Forest - Sawmill

Nolde Forest - Sawmill is a stunning state park located in Pennsylvania, providing visitors with an exceptional opportunity to immerse themselves in nature. The park features an extensive network of trails that meander through enchanting woodlands, alongside babbling creeks, and past captivating natural landscapes. As you wander along these paths, you will encounter a rich diversity of plant and animal life, making it a perfect spot for both leisurely walks and more challenging hikes. One of the highlights of Nolde Forest is the educational center, which offers informative displays and programs about the local ecosystem, wildlife, and conservation efforts. This center serves as a fantastic resource for families and nature lovers looking to deepen their understanding of the environment. The park also features a beautiful creek, where visitors can relax and enjoy the soothing sounds of flowing water, providing a tranquil escape from the hustle and bustle of daily life.
